Struct canadensis_data_types::uavcan::pnp::node_id_allocation_data_1_0::NodeIDAllocationData [−][src]
Expand description
uavcan.pnp.NodeIDAllocationData.1.0
Size ranges from 7 to 9 bytes
Fields
unique_id_hash: u64
truncated uint48
Always aligned Size 48 bits
allocated_node_id: Vec<ID, 1>
uavcan.node.ID.1.0[<=1]
Always aligned Size ranges from 0 to 16 bits
Trait Implementations
The sealed or delimited property of this type
fn deserialize(cursor: &mut ReadCursor<'_>) -> Result<Self, DeserializeError> where
Self: Sized,
fn deserialize(cursor: &mut ReadCursor<'_>) -> Result<Self, DeserializeError> where
Self: Sized,
Deserializes a value and returns it
Deserializes a value from a slice of bytes and returns it Read more
A convenience function that creates a cursor around the provided bytes and calls
deserialize
Read more